电缆线路改造引起的护层感应电压变化及其补偿

摘    要:电力电缆线路改造时交叉互联后容易造成换位的三段电缆不等长,从而引起护层感应电压不平衡。本文通过对电缆护层感应电压的理论分析,提出了在末端电缆护层上连接电感元件进行电压补偿的方法,可有效地减小由于护层感应电压不平衡所造成的影响。

Change of the induced sheath voltage due to renovation of power lines and its compensation

Abstract:During the renovation of power cable lines,the cross interconnection usually give rise to three sections of transposed cables with different lengths,which will cause unbalanced induced sheath voltage.By theoretical analysis of the induced sheath voltage,this paper suggests a method to make voltage compensation,in which an inductance element is connected to the sheath end and thus reduces the effect caused by the unbalanced induced sheath voltage.
